发布于 2026-01-06 7 阅读
0

The Top 10 GitHub Repositories Making Waves 🌊📊 Reactive Resume Serverless Framework - V.4 Project Based Learning Coding Interview University Software Engineering Blogs Lobe Chat DEV's Worldwide Show and Tell Challenge Presented by Mux: Pitch Your Projects!

最热门的 10 个 GitHub 代码库 🌊📊

响应式简历

Serverless Framework - V.4

基于项目的学习

编程面试大学

软件工程博客惊人的

脑叶聊天

由 Mux 主办的 DEV 全球展示挑战赛:展示你的项目!

介绍

GitHub 是一个广受欢迎的软件和 Web 开发协作平台,它提供了许多有助于优化流程的实用工具。在本文中,我整理了一份备受推崇的 GitHub 代码库合集,旨在帮助您节省时间,并找到最适合您项目的资源。

GitHub

1. esProc SPL

GitHub |网站

esProc SPL(结构化过程语言)是一种专为强大的数据操作而设计的编程语言,可高效地用作分析型数据库中间件。如果您想要一个更具说服力的定义,它是SQL 的绝佳替代方案。

  • 它通过语法支持原生文件计算,既简单又方便。📊

  • 它是一种用于数据处理的脚本语言,拥有精心设计的函数集和强大的脚本语法支持。💻

  • 提供独立于数据库的轻量级计算能力,支持 CSV、Excel、SQL、多层 JSON 和 XML 计算。🔄

  • 可轻松融入任何数据处理环境。能够完美地对各种数据源执行类似 SQL 的计算。🌐

  • 与 Stream、Kotlin 或 Scala 相比,其处理能力遥遥领先。🚀

  • 一个性价比极高的解决方案。💰

超越 SQL

  • 支持完整集合方向,允许分离成员并进行有序计算。⚙️

  • 提供更丰富的集合运算库并支持 lambda 语法。📚

  • 允许集合成员独立存在,方便查阅。🔄

它可以通过 Java 程序中的 JDBC_[Java 数据库连接]_ 接口执行,为使用 SQL 提供了另一种选择,表明了它在各种面向数据的应用程序中的灵活性。

GitHub 标志 SPLWare / esProc

esProc SPL 是一种基于 JVM 的编程语言,专为结构化数据计算而设计,既可用作数据分析工具,也可用作嵌入式计算引擎。

关于 esProc SPL

esProc SPL 是一种编程语言。与大多数基于文本的编程语言不同,SPL 代码编写在类似 Excel 的网格中,并且就像在 Excel 中一样,您可以实时查看执行结果的逐步过程。这降低了初学者的学习难度,并提供了出色的交互式体验。图像

SPL 提供分支、循环甚至递归等标准编程语言特性。值得注意的是,SPL 拥有强大的集合运算能力,使代码更加简洁。例如,著名的八皇后问题只需几行代码即可解决。图像

您可以访问以下网址进行尝试:https://try.esproc.com/splx?3VU,并访问以下网址查找更多代码示例:https://c.esproc.com/article/1688024127696#toc_h2_2

SPL 代表结构化处理语言,其主要目标是进行结构化数据计算。目前,SQL 是该领域的主流语言,但 SQL 存在诸多局限性,通常需要借助 Python 等外部工具才能完成完整的计算任务。SPL……

2. 响应式恢复

GitHub |网站

Reactive Resumes致力于通过提供既实用又注重隐私的简历创建体验,帮助求职者提升求职效率。🛡️

这款在线工具简单易用,不到一分钟即可完成设置,并且支持多种语言。🌐

它提供实时编辑功能、多种格式选项和简单的拖放式自定义功能,并集成了人工智能(OpenAI)以增强写作体验。🤖

该平台提供字体选择、各种模板,甚至还有夜间模式,带来更舒适的观看体验。🌙

GitHub 标志 AmruthPillai /反应式简历

一款独一无二的简历制作工具,充分保障您的隐私。完全安全、可定制、便携、开源且永久免费。立即体验!

曲速赞助

适用于 macOS、Linux 和 Windows


响应式简历

应用版本 Docker拉取 GitHub赞助商 克劳丁 Discord

响应式简历

一款免费开源的简历制作工具,可简化创建、更新和分享简历的过程。

描述

Reactive Resume 是一款免费开源的简历制作工具,它简化了简历的创建、更新和分享流程。我们承诺零用户追踪和广告,将您的隐私放在首位。该平台极其易用,如果您希望完全掌控自己的数据,只需不到 30 秒即可完成自托管。

它支持多种语言,并具备实时编辑、数十种模板、拖放式自定义以及与 OpenAI 集成等诸多功能,可增强您的写作体验。

您可以向潜在雇主分享个性化的简历链接,追踪简历的浏览量和下载量,并通过拖放操作自定义页面布局。该平台还支持多种……

3. 我们喜欢的论文

GitHub |网站

Papers We Love (PWL) 是一个围绕阅读、讨论和学习计算机科学学术论文而建立的社区。📚

这个资源库汇集了社区能找到的一些最优秀的论文,将散落在网络各处的文档集中起来。🌐

它既是一个学术计算机科学论文库,也是一个热爱阅读这些论文的社区。🎓

GitHub 标志 我们喜爱的纸张/我们喜爱的纸张

计算机科学界的论文,供阅读和讨论。

我们喜爱的报纸

Discord

Papers We Love ( PWL ) 是一个围绕阅读、讨论和学习计算机科学学术论文而建立的社区。该资源库汇集了社区成员找到的一些最佳论文,将散落在网络上的文档整合在一起。您也可以访问Papers We Love 网站了解更多信息。

由于许可限制,我们无法始终托管论文本身(如果托管,您会在目录 README 中看到论文标题旁边有一个 📜 表情符号),但我们可以提供论文所在位置的链接。

如果您喜欢这些论文,不妨参加当地分会的聚会,加入到围绕这些论文的热烈讨论中。您也可以在我们的Discord服务器上讨论PWL活动、本仓库中的内容,以及任何与PWL相关的话题。

章节

如果您有兴趣在您所在的城市创办一家,请告诉我们!

我们所有的聚会……

4. 无服务器

GitHub |网站

Serverless Framework 是一款用于在 AWS Lambda 和其他现代云服务上开发应用程序的工具。⚙️

它能让您的应用程序自动扩展,并且仅在运行时产生费用,这有助于降低成本,让您将更多精力集中在构建而非管理上。🌐

这款用户友好的命令行工具使用简单的 YAML 语法来部署您的代码以及无服务器应用程序场景所需的云基础设施。💻

它支持 Node.js、Typescript、Python、Go、Java 等多种编程语言。🤖

此外,它还可通过 1000 多个插件轻松定制,这些插件可扩展其功能,在框架内提供无服务器用例和工作流程。🛠️

GitHub 标志 无服务器/无服务器

⚡ Serverless Framework – 使用 AWS Lambda 和其他托管云服务,轻松构建可自动扩展、空闲时零成本且维护量极低的应用程序。

Serverless Framework、AWS Lambda、AWS DynamoDB 和 AWS API Gateway


网站  •  文档  •  X / Twitter  •  Slack 社区  •  论坛


Serverless 框架——让您能够轻松使用 AWS Lambda 和其他托管云服务来构建可自动扩展、空闲时无需任何费用且维护成本极低的应用程序。

Serverless Framework 是一个命令行工具,它采用易于理解的 YAML 语法,可以部署代码和云基础设施,从而支持各种无服务器应用程序用例,例如 API、前端、数据管道和定时任务。它是一个多语言框架,支持 Node.js、TypeScript、Python、Go、Java 等多种语言。此外,它还拥有超过 1000 个插件,可以扩展框架的功能,添加更多无服务器用例和工作流程。

由Serverless Inc.积极维护


Serverless Framework - V.4


2025年8月– V.4版本持续推出重大更新。请查看以下全部更新内容。2025年,我们开始发布一些大型项目,例如无服务器容器框架无服务器MCP ……

5. 基于项目的学习

Github

探索专为有志成为软件开发人员的人士设计的循序渐进指南。这些教程按编程语言分类,涵盖各种不同的技术和语言。🚀

GitHub 标志 实践教程/项目式学习

精选项目式教程列表

基于项目的学习

吉特

这是一份编程教程列表,旨在帮助有志成为软件开发人员的人从零开始构建应用程序。这些教程按主要编程语言分类,有些教程甚至涉及多种技术和语言。

首先,只需 fork 此仓库即可。有关贡献指南,请参阅CONTRIBUTING.md文件。

目录:

C/C++:

6. 大学编程面试

Github

本仓库包含一份软件工程师培训课程示例大纲:

起点
基本的编程知识(变量、循环、方法/函数)。
耐心和时间投入。

专注于软件工程
注意:本课程是软件工程,不是前端或全栈开发。

设备
欲了解更多有关开发领域职业发展路径的信息,请访问https://roadmap.sh/
如需详细的自学计划,请参阅 Kamran Ahmed 的计算机科学路线图:https://roadmap.sh/computer-science

大学教学
请注意,大学的计算机科学课程涵盖众多领域。但通常来说,了解大约75%的内容就足以应付面试了。

专注学习
花时间持续学习和练习编程。
利用计算机科学指南中的资源,加深理解。

遵循这个计划,你可以逐步培养成为一名成功软件工程师所需的技能。🌟

GitHub 标志 jwasham /编码面试大学

一份完整的计算机科学学习计划,助你成为软件工程师。

编程面试大学

我最初创建这个清单只是为了列出成为软件工程师所需的学习主题,但后来它发展成了你现在看到的这份长长的清单。完成这份学习计划后,我成功入职亚马逊,成为一名软件开发工程师。你可能不需要像我一样投入那么多时间学习。总之,你需要的一切都在这里。

我每天学习大约 8-12 个小时,持续了好几个月。这就是我的故事:为什么我为了谷歌面试全职学习了 8 个月

请注意:你不需要像我一样花那么多时间学习。我浪费了很多时间在不需要知道的事情上。更多信息请见下文。我会帮助你节省宝贵的时间,顺利达成目标。

这里列出的内容将帮助你为几乎所有软件公司的技术面试做好充分准备,包括……

7. 工程博客

Github

探索我们精心挑选的工程博客合集,涵盖不同的技术和软件开发主题;这些博客对于想要深入了解工程实践和编码的人来说弥足珍贵。🚀

8. lencx/ChatGPT

GitHub |网站

要在您的个人电脑上体验 ChatGPT,请下载 ChatGPT 桌面应用程序,该应用程序可在 Mac、Windows 和 Linux 系统上运行,实现流畅的交互体验。💬

GitHub 标志 lencx / ChatGPT

🔮 ChatGPT 桌面应用程序(Mac、Windows 和 Linux)

ChatGPT

ChatGPT桌面应用程序(适用于Mac、Windows和Linux)

ChatGPT 下载 聊天 叽叽喳喳 YouTube

请我喝杯咖啡


笔记

如果您想体验更强大的 AI 封装应用程序,可以尝试 Noi(https://github.com/lencx/Noi),它是 ChatGPT 桌面应用程序概念的后续产品。

非常感谢您对本项目关注。OpenAI 现已发布 macOS 版本,Windows 版本稍后推出(向 ChatGPT 免费用户介绍 GPT-4o 及更多工具)。如果您更喜欢官方应用程序,可以关注 OpenAI 的最新动态。

如果您想了解或下载以前的版本(v1.1.0),请点击这里

我目前正在寻找一些差异化功能来开发 2.0 版本。如果您对此感兴趣,请继续关注。




9. 自建X

GitHub |网站

这个代码库汇集了精心编写的循序渐进指南,教你如何从零开始重现你最喜欢的技术。通过从头开始构建你最喜欢的技术,提升你的编程能力。💻

10. 叶状聊天

GitHub |网站

Lobe Chat 是一个出色的聊天机器人框架,它拥有高性能和语音合成、多模态等功能。此外,其函数调用插件系统使其易于扩展。您可以一键免费部署您的私有 ChatGPT 或 LLM Web 应用。Lobe Chat 让您轻松创建高级聊天机器人!🤖

GitHub 标志 叶状体中心/叶状体聊天

🤯 LobeHub——一个开源、设计现代的AI代理工作空​​间。支持多个AI提供商、知识库(文件上传/RAG)、一键安装MCP Marketplace和Artifacts/Thinking。一键免费部署您的私有AI代理应用程序。

笔记

版本信息

  • v1.x(稳定版):可在main分支上获取
  • v2.x(开发中):目前正在next🔥 分支上积极开发中

脑叶聊天

一款开源、设计现代的 ChatGPT/LLMs 用户界面/框架。
支持语音合成、多模态和可扩展(函数调用)插件系统。
一键免费部署您的私有 OpenAI ChatGPT/Claude/Gemini/Groq/Ollama 聊天应用程序。

English ·简体中文·官方网站·更新日志·文档·博客·反馈




分享 LobeChat 代码库

引领思维与创造的新时代。专为像您这样卓越的个体而打造。



Vercel OSS 程序

Table of contents

目录

结论

以上就是 GitHub 上最热门的 10 个代码库。我们的探索到此结束。希望这些信息对您有所帮助,也希望您阅读愉快。🌟

祝您编程愉快!🚀
感谢您的10330次点赞!

文章来源:https://dev.to/arjuncodess/the-top-10-github-repositories-making-waves-4p1o